WebThe hematopoietic system, which comprises all the cellular components of the blood, is one of the earliest organ systems to evolve during embryo development. Hematopoietic stem cells (HSCs), which are rare blood cells residing in the bone marrow of the adult organism, are the founder cells that give rise to the entire hematopoietic system. WebLittle is known about the molecular mechanisms that direct the transition from primitive to definitive hematopoiesis. In this study, we cocultured murine embryonic stem (ES) cells on OP9 stroma to induce hematopoietic differentiation as a model to study factors involved in the generation of adult hematopoietic stem cells (HSCs). WebWirnsberger et al. (2014) found that knockout of Jagn1 in mice caused lethality around embryonic day 8.5. Mice carrying a hematopoietic lineage-specific deletion of Jagn1, called Jagn1(delta-hem) mice, appeared normal and showed no gross abnormalities in total cellularity or composition of mesenteric lymph nodes, spleen, thymus, or bone marrow. family court haverfordwest
